Download presentation
Presentation is loading. Please wait.
1
Web Page Introduction
2
What is a web page? A web page is a text file containing markup language tags. A markup language combines text and extra information about the text's structure or presentation using markup, which is intermingled with the primary text. <H1> Britain calls for direct talks with Iran </H1>
3
Markup Languages HTML5: Hyper Text MarkUp Language (HTML)
XML: Extensible Markup Language a general-purpose markup language User-defined tags: <AuthorName>John Smith</AuthorName> Ex: c:\inetpub\wwwroot\facoritebook.xml Cascade Style Sheet, CSS XHTML: Extensible HyperText Markup Language XHTML is the successor to HTML HTML + XML HTML5: HTML,+ XML + improving support for the latest multimedia cross-platform mobile applications
4
XML with Stylesheet Example
<?xml version = "1.0" ?> <?xml-stylesheet type="text/css" href="books.css" ?> <Books> <Book> <btitle>My Favorite Book</btitle> <ISBN> </ISBN> <Authors> <AuthorName>John Smith</AuthorName> <AuthorName>Peter Chen</AuthorName> </Authors> <Price> $45.00</Price> <Description>This is a grerat book</Description> </Book> <btitle>My Second Favorite Book</btitle> <ISBN> </ISBN> <AuthorName>Adam Smith</AuthorName> <Price> $25.00</Price> <Description>This is a second great book</Description> </Books>
5
Style Sheet Example btitle { display:block;
font-family: Aerial, Helvetica; font-weight: bold; font-size: 20pt; color: #9370db; text-align: center; } ISBN { font-size: 12pt; color: #c71585; text-align: left; Authors { display:inline; font-style: italic; font-size: 10pt; Price { color: #ff1010; Description {
6
Types of Web pages Static page: Dynamic page
The contents of a web page is predefined by HTML tags. Example: david chao’s home page. Dynamic page A web page includes contents produced by a programming language when the page is opened. Examples: Pages that display current date/time, visitor counter Yahoo home page Pages that display results based on a database query. Yahoo’s Finance/Enter symbol/Historical prices
7
Technologies for Creating Dynamic Pages
Client-side technology JavaScript Server-side technology Microsoft .Net PHP Java
8
Basic HTML Tags <html> </html>
<title> </title> <body> </body> <h1> </h1>: large text <h6> </h6>: smallest text Reference tag: <a href=“cake.jpg”> <p> </P>: Paragraph tag <img> Image tag
9
Example <html> <title>David Chao HTML Demo</title><p> <body> <h1>Welcome to David Chao’s Home Page</h1> <hr> <a href="CAKE.JPG">Click here to see a cake picture</a><p></body> </html>
10
Online Resources for Learning HTML
w3schools.com
11
Web Page Editors DreamWeaver and many others MS Word
With support to develop dynamic page with script languages MS Word Open a new document Save As: Web Page Internet free editor: Wix free website builder
12
Creating Web Page with MS Word
Text: Alignment, Size, Font, Bold Link Existing page, place in document, Table List BookMark BackGround Page layout/Page Color Picture Form mailto: Address
13
Creating Website Using WIX
Need an account Choose a template View Edit Customize design Manage pages Save/preview My Account
14
Typical Web Site Contents
About Us Company organization Mission Products/Services Partner organizations Clients Information for users Links to relevant sites Contact Us
15
Publishing Web Pages Web server Creating web pages using editor
Default directory, default home page Virtual directory Creating web pages using editor Transfer web pages to web server: FTP, File Transfer Program
Similar presentations
© 2024 SlidePlayer.com. Inc.
All rights reserved.